A new report by All Things D states that the next iPhone will be announced at a special September 10th event.  This report comes shortly after Apple-insider Jim Dalrymple “Nope’d” the original rumor of a September 6th event as reported by MacRumors.  While nothing has been officially confirmed, All Things D does have a good track record with regard to many rumors.

A new iPhone is something Apple needs in order to continue to compete in the smartphone marketplace.  However, despite not having released a new iPhone for just about a year now, Apple still sold over 30 million iPhones in its last quarter.  Additionally, rumors of a lower-cost and more colorful plastic iPhone (dubbed the iPhone 5C) have also been swirling around the web.  Lastly, I’d say no matter when the iPhone event is, it’s safe to expect that the final version of iOS 7 will be released alongside the next iPhone.
